I've been reading that with the returnless fuel system on 99+ Mustangs, a typical fuel pump won't work. Apparently they burn out real quick and you need to get a variable voltage, or vane, type pump. I've heard on another board that Walbro makes 255 lph vane one but wasn't able to get a part number. Has anyone else seen this pump or have a part number for it.
Like you've read... the Walbro pumps aren't designed to work with the returnless setup. You have several options... a Chicane-style pump, the 03 Cobra setup, or a KB Boost-A-Pump. KB includes the BAP in their blower kits for the 2V, I think it'd be more than adequate for your use, and it runs around $200 I believe. Pete at Fordchip sells the Chicane pumps, I think they are around $289 or so.

i had the walbro 255 in my car for about a year with no problems...i had nitrous and the blower with it...the only real difference i saw was, the fuel pressure was a little jumpy at idle and cruise, but it never went lean. once the 03 cobra fuel pump went in however, the fuel pressure leveled out and smoothed out.
